US Dollar drops by 10 cents

Date:

The sell price of the US Dollar marks Rs. 364.63 according to the CBSL Exchange Rate. Accordingly, the US Dollar has depreciated by 10 cents against the last exchange rate.

The buy price of the US Dollar marks Rs. 354.66.

Despite a significant difference between the exchange rates of the CBSL and the exchange rates in of commercial banks of Sri Lanka being visible in the past, commercial banks are now selling the dollar close to the CBSL standards.
